Richard Eugene Layton, 79, Springfield, passed away at 8:41 a.m. Monday, October 7, 2013 He was born December 13, 1933 in Hollister, MO. He was preceded in death by his son, Anthony Paul Layton. Richard is survived by his loving wife, Barbara Layton; two daughters, Veronica Crawford and husband, Robert; Teresa Layton; a brother, Dale Layton, two sisters, Louise Macom, and Margie Bradley, four grandchildren, Tara and her husband, Casey Lau, Justin Coller, Renee Tonkinson and Tess Lieb; and one great-granddaughter, Tatum Lau. Richard served over 20 years in the US Air Force, during that time he served in SAC Air Command, Air Training Command, TAT Air Command, and European Air Command. He received the Air Force Commendation Medal plus many other achievements and awards. He received the professional award from Eastman Kodak and many other corporate awards. Upon retirement from the Air Force he worked for 20 years for Colonial Baking Company as their Chief Industrial Manager, which was owned by Anheuser Bush. His hobbies were reading, fishing, woodworking, working on clocks, and his dog Pixie. Richard was the man who taught others about ethics, moral values, hard work, and love. We all cherished his quiet relationship and his talks about dogs, his inside jokes, his view of the world, his military career, and his stories of growing up in a tough environment making him the strong man we admired so. The few words he spoke of encouragement and love were sincere, you knew they were true and from the heart, we will never forget those words. We all love you and will never forget.
